
Starting from 2010, the BDC and CMA organize the “Hong Kong Emerging Brand Awards” and “Hong Kong Emerging Service Brand Awards” every year. By selecting up-and-coming young brandnames aged less than 8 years, they aim to encourage the industries especially SMEs to embrace an enterprising spirit and to enhance the value-added attributes and the competitive edges of Hong Kong products and services through brand-building.
To be eligible, an entry brandname for the Awards should be established in Hong Kong or have substantially close relations with Hong Kong; and the entry company should have been registered in Hong Kong, and possess exclusive rights to fully control the production, distribution or other operational activities under the entry brandname.
Entrants have to go through a rigorous vetting process comprising Review of Judging Panel and On-site Assessment. The judging is primarily based on six criteria, namely Reputation (Hong Kong, Mainland & Overseas), Distinctiveness, Innovation, Quality, Image, as well as Environmental Performance & Social Responsibility.
